1961 Decatur Commodores Statistics

The Decatur Commodores of the Midwest League ended the 1961 season with a record of 57 wins and 65 losses, finishing sixth in the MWL.

The Commodores scored 634 runs and conceded 637 runs. Jim Northrup led Decatur with 13 home runs and drove in 73 runs. Larry Rojas paced batters with significant playing time by connecting at a .302 clip. Vernon Orndorff topped the squad with 11 wins, while Ray Cordeiro recorded a 1.77 ERA, tops among regularly-used pitchers.

Players from the 1961 Decatur Commodores who spent time in Major League Baseball during their careers included Jim Northrup, Don Bryant, Vern Holtgrave and Mickey Stanley.

Johnny Groth served as manager.
